Upgrade to Energy-Efficient Models
Updating to energy-efficient models is a pivotal action in improving the total performance of your heating and cooling system and heating system. These contemporary units are developed to take in much less energy while delivering optimal heating and cooling, causing considerable cost savings on utility bills and a minimized environmental impact.
When thinking about an upgrade, search for designs that have high Seasonal Energy Effectiveness Ratios (SEER) for air conditioning and Annual Gas Application Effectiveness (AFUE) rankings for furnaces. These scores indicate the effectiveness of the devices, with greater numbers showing far better efficiency. Energy-efficient versions frequently integrate innovative technologies, such as variable-speed motors and wise thermostats, which better boost power financial savings.
Furthermore, lots of energy-efficient HVAC systems are geared up with boosted insulation and far better securing, which lessen energy loss and improve interior convenience. air conditioner repair. While the first financial investment may be greater, the lasting financial savings on power expenses and potential tax incentives for making use of energy-efficient devices can counter this cost considerably

Optimize System Settings
To maximize the efficiency of your HVAC system and furnace, it home is important to enhance system settings tailored to your details demands. Begin by setting your thermostat to an energy-efficient temperature. The United State Division of Power recommends a winter season setup of 68 ° F when you are awake and lowering it while you rest or are away. In summertime, purpose for 78 ° F throughout the day.
Use programmable or wise thermostats that permit you to arrange temperature adjustments automatically. This ensures your system operates only when required, lowering power intake. Additionally, guarantee that your system is established to run in the proper setting-- home heating in winter and cooling in summer season-- while staying clear of the continual follower option unless required for air flow.
Consistently testimonial and adjust setups based on seasonal adjustments, occupancy patterns, and particular convenience preferences. Likewise, make sure that vents and signs up are unblocked, permitting optimal air movement. Finally, think about zoning systems that allow customized comfort in various areas of your home, additionally enhancing performance. By fine-tuning these settings, you can attain considerable power cost savings while maintaining a comfy living environment.
Improve Insulation and Sealing
A well-insulated home is key to making the most of the efficiency of your Heating and cooling system and heater. Proper insulation lowers the workload on these systems, therefore conserving power and lowering energy bills.
Along with insulation, sealing spaces and splits is essential. Pay unique attention to windows, doors, and any kind of penetrations in walls, such as electric outlets and pipes components. Weatherstripping and caulking can properly seal these openings, stopping drafts that endanger your HVAC efficiency.
Additionally, make sure that ducts are properly shielded and secured. Dripping air ducts can bring about significant power losses, reducing system performance. Using mastic sealer or steel tape to secure air duct joints can improve air movement and performance.
Arrange Normal Maintenance
Normal upkeep of your heating and cooling system and heating system is important for ensuring ideal efficiency and durability. Arranged evaluations and maintenance can identify prospective issues before they escalate, stopping pricey repair work and view publisher site inadequacies. During maintenance, a qualified professional will clean up and replace filters, check cooling agent degrees, inspect ductwork for leaks, and assess overall system procedure. This positive method not just improves energy performance but additionally lengthens the life-span of your equipment.
